East Rutherford Zoning Board memorializes two resolutions, carries 39 Wall Street to June 4

At its May 7 meeting the board approved amended April minutes, memorialized two resolutions (ZB 26‑03 and ZB 26‑04) and agreed to carry the 39 Wall Street application to June 4 without further notice.

The East Rutherford Zoning Board of Adjustment on May 7, 2026 approved amended minutes for its April 2 meeting, memorialized two resolutions and carried one pending application to the board’s June 4 meeting.

The board memorialized Resolution ZB 26‑03 for 232 & 238 Grove Street and Resolution ZB 26‑04 for 111 Union Avenue; the record reflects the memorializations were approved by the members present. The board also recorded the approval of amended minutes for its April 2, 2026 meeting.

For Docket #25‑11 (39 Wall Street), board secretary William Justis reported a May 1, 2026 letter from attorney Joseph Wenzel on behalf of applicant Gesly Torres asking to adjourn the hearing to June 4, 2026 without further notice. The board moved to carry that application to the June 4 meeting and the motion passed; Chairman Philip Alberta announced the June 4 date to the public.

With no further business before the board, members moved to close the meeting and adjourned at 9:46 p.m. Minutes were prepared by Board Secretary William Justis.
